wthrmn654 Posted February 19, 2022 Share Posted February 19, 2022 Mesoscale Discussion 0156 NWS Storm Prediction Center Norman OK 1158 AM CST Sat Feb 19 2022 Areas affected...CT...RI...MA...NJ...southeast NY...eastern PA...southern portions of VT and NH...northern portions of MD and DE Concerning...Snow Squall Valid 191758Z - 192200Z SUMMARY...An intense snow squall will continue to accompany an arctic cold front as it moves rapidly east this afternoon, resulting in a brief period of blizzard/near-blizzard conditions. DISCUSSION...Composite radar imagery continues to show an intense snow squall accompanying a strong cold front that was moving rapidly east (near 40 kt) across portions of the northeast U.S. at 1755z. Surface observations and time-lapse camera imagery show rapid deterioration of visibility along with accumulating snow as the snow squall moves through, with several METAR observations reporting brief blizzard conditions. In the presence of strong and focused ascent along the front through low-level convergence, low/mid-level frontogenetic forcing and rapidly cooling surface temperatures, the majority of latest high-res guidance supports a continuation of the snow squall as it moves east with the cold front through much of the remainder of this afternoon. A brief period of heavy snow along with wind gusts of 35-45 mph will result in blizzard or near-blizzard conditions as visibility is quickly reduced to at or below 1/4 mile.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
